Death in the Principality of Liechtenstein

If a Liechtenstein citizen or a foreigner resident in Liechtenstein dies in the Principality of Liechtenstein, the Liechtenstein Civil Registry Office is notified by the Office of Public Health by means of a medical death certificate.
Subsequently, the Liechtenstein Civil Registry Office draws up the death record (inheritance certificate), which is forwarded to the municipality of residence of the deceased person. This in turn collects the inventory and forwards the documents to the Princely Land Court for the probate proceedings.
